Lahstedt

Lahstedt is a former municipality in the district of Peine, in Lower Saxony, Germany.

Lahstedt was formed on 1 February 1971 by merging the five villages of Adenstedt, Gadenstedt, Groß Lafferde, Münstedt and Oberg.

Since 1 January 2015 its subdivisions are part of the municipality Ilsede.
